#01a102 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#01a102 is composed of 0.4% red, 63.1% green and 0.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 99.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 98.8% yellow and 36.9% black. It has a hue angle of 120.4 degrees, a saturation of 98.8% and a lightness of 31.8%. #01a102 color hex could be obtained by blending #02ff04 with #004300. Closest websafe color is: #009900.

Shades and Tints of #01a102
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000500 is the darkest color, while #f1fff1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#01a102
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4c564c is the less saturated color, while #01a102 is the most saturated one.
